Objective:Atherosclerosis is a main cause of cerebral infarction, and intra-andextracranial atherosclerosis are the most common causes of cerebral infarction. In manyclassifications of ischemic stroke, cerebral infarction with unclear cause holds a largeproportion. Domestic and foreign researches on aortic arch atherosclerosis are less in thepast, many clinical observations find that the aortic arch plaques(AAP) may be the maincause of cerebral infarction with unclear cause. This study is to explore the risk factorsof the aortic arch atherosclerosis and to investigate the relevance between aortic archatherosclerosis and intra-and extracranial atherosclerosis. This has important clinicalsignificance to find out the cause of cerebral infarction and reduce the proportion ofinfarctions with unclear cause.Method:Total140patients with ischemic stroke/transient ischemic attack(TIA)were enrolled from November,2010to February,2012in the first affiliated hospital ofDalian Medical University. Take CTA examination to their aortic arch and internal andexternal cranial arteries. According to the appearance of the aortic atheroscleroticplaques, we divide the patients to plaque group and control group. Detect the hs-CRP、total cholesterol、LDL-C、LP(a)、HCY、, triglycerides and other indicators from theserum of the two groups patients. And then use statistics to analyze them. Also, usestatistics to analyze the relevance between aortic arch atherosclerosis and internal andexternal atherosclerosis.Result:1. Advanced age(>65),male,smocking,high blood pressure,diabetes,high HCY, high total cholesterol, high triglycerides, high LDL, high LP(a), low HDL-C, the ESSEN score≥3are related to the aortic arch atherosclerosis(P<0.05),female and fibrinogen have no relationship to aortic arch atherosclerosis(P> 0.05).2.The amount of risk factors aggregate has significant difference in the formationof aortic arch atherosclerosis.3. Of all the140patients,110cases we found aorticarch atherosclerotic plaque (AAP),97cases we detected external cranial atheroscleroticplaques,107cases we detected internal cranial atherosclerotic plaques. Patients withaortic arch plaque(AAP) have higher incidence of extracranial atherosclerosis(81cases,83.5%) than the patients without AAP (16cases,17.5%),OR=3.232,P=0.01.Alsopatients with AAP have higher incidence of intracranial atherosclerosis(93cases,86.9%) than the patients without AAP(14cases,13.1%),OR=1.411,P=0.02.Conclusion:1.Advanced age, male, smoking, high blood pressure, diabetes,high HCY, high total cholesterol, high triglycerides, high LDL-C, high level of LP(a)、low level of HDL-C are the important independent risk factors of the AAP.2.The moredifferent risk factors accumulate, the greater of the risk of aortic archatherosclerosis.3.Aortic arch atherosclerosis has clear relevance with intra-andextracranial atherosclerosis.
